FDA Alerts on Non-Sterile BD ChloraPrep Applicators in Medline Convenience Kits

The FDA has issued an alert regarding potential sterility issues with BD ChloraPrep Applicators in Medline's Convenience Kits.

Why it matters

The FDA's alert regarding non-sterile BD ChloraPrep Applicators poses a significant risk to Medline's reputation and could lead to a loss of market share in the infection control segment. Pharma strategy teams must assess the implications of this safety signal and develop mitigation strategies to protect brand integrity and customer trust.
